Trichomoniasis (for Parents) - Nemours KidsHealth

WebTrichomoniasis is an STD caused by a parasite called Trichomonas vaginalis. This protozoan travels easily in sexual fluids, including vaginal fluids, pre-ejaculate, and semen. … WebTrichomoniasis spreads when someone has penis-to-vagina or vagina-to-vagina contact with an infected person(s). Women can get the disease from infected men and women, but men usually contract it only from infected women.

A man can carry the infection for 5 to 28 days without showing any trich symptoms. During sex, the parasite usually spreads from a penis to a vagina or from a vagina to a penis. Even if a man does not ejaculate during sex, trich can still spread to the woman through genital touching.
